lymphedema chemotherapy Chronic swelling caused by damage to the lymphatic system, known as lymphedema, is a common concern for many cancer survivors. This condition often arises after treatments like chemotherapy, which, while essential for fighting cancer, can also increase the risk of lymphatic complications.
According to the American Cancer Society, 20-40% of breast cancer survivors experience lymphedema post-treatment. This highlights the dual role of chemotherapy—it is both a life-saving treatment and a potential contributor to long-term health challenges.
Understanding Lymphedema and Its Connection to Chemotherapy
Protein-rich fluid buildup often occurs when lymph nodes face damage during cancer care. This condition disrupts normal fluid drainage, leading to swelling in arms, legs, or other body parts.
What Is This Condition?
The lymphatic system relies on vessels and nodes to filter waste and fight infections. When blocked or damaged, fluid accumulates in soft tissues. Over time, this can cause discomfort and reduced mobility.
How Treatment Affects Lymphatic Health
Certain cancer treatments, like taxanes, target fast-growing cells—including those lining lymphatic vessels. Studies show 30% of patients develop complications like scarring or valve damage (Mayo Clinic).
Radiation or surgery near clusters of nodes worsens risks. For example, breast cancer patients may experience arm swelling if axillary nodes are removed or irradiated.
- Key factors: Treatment type, dosage, and affected area influence severity.
- Prevention: Early detection and gentle exercises can mitigate risks.
The Role of the Lymphatic System in Cancer Treatment
The lymphatic system plays a vital role in both immunity and fluid balance, making it crucial during cancer care. It works alongside blood vessels to remove waste and fight infections. When functioning well, it filters 2–3 liters of fluid daily (ACS).
Functions of the Lymphatic System
This network includes nodes, vessels, and organs like the spleen. Its two main jobs are:
- Immune defense: Nodes trap bacteria and present antigens to white blood cells.
- Fluid regulation: Vessels return excess fluid from tissues to the bloodstream.
| Feature | Lymphatic Vessels | Blood Vessels |
|---|---|---|
| Main Role | Waste removal, immunity | Oxygen/nutrient delivery |
| Fluid Transport | Lymph (clear fluid) | Blood (red, oxygen-rich) |
| Pressure | Low | High |
Why Lymph Nodes Are Affected During Cancer Treatment
Cancer often spreads through the lymph network—95% of metastases use this route (NCI). Treatments like surgery or radiation may damage nodes or vessels. For example:
- Biopsies: Needed for staging but can disrupt flow.
- Radiation: Raises swelling risks by 40% (NCCN).
Even targeted drugs may scar capillaries, reducing drainage over time.
How Chemotherapy Can Lead to Lymphedema
Certain cancer treatments can impact lymphatic function, leading to fluid retention. When drugs damage vessel walls or nodes, drainage slows, causing swelling over time.
Mechanisms of Lymphedema Development
Taxane-based regimens may trigger cell death in lymphatic vessels. This disrupts proteins that maintain vessel structure, worsening fluid buildup. Studies show a 58% higher risk with these drugs.

Common Symptoms of Lymphedema After Chemotherapy
Many patients first notice subtle changes in their limbs before swelling becomes visible. Early detection improves outcomes, with 83% reporting heaviness as the first clue (LANA). Awareness of these signs helps initiate timely care.
Early Signs to Watch For
Initial symptoms often include tightness in rings or sleeves. The Stemmer’s sign test—pinching skin on toes or fingers—can reveal digital edema. Other indicators:
- Arm or leg fatigue without exertion
- Mild puffiness that temporarily improves with elevation
- Skin feeling thicker or warmer in one area
How Symptoms Progress Without Intervention
Stage 1 involves pitting edema (indents when pressed, per ISL). Over time, swelling becomes persistent. The arm or leg may harden due to fibrosis, limiting mobility. Photos comparing stages highlight these changes vividly.
Emotional impacts, like body image struggles, often accompany physical symptoms. Tracking daily fluctuations in a diary helps patients and doctors tailor management plans.
Stages of Lymphedema: From Mild to Severe
lymphedema chemotherapy Medical professionals classify fluid retention into distinct stages. Early intervention can slow progression and improve quality of life. Below are the clinical criteria defined by the International Society of Lymphology (ISL).
Stage 0: Latent Lymphedema
No visible swelling occurs, but subtle changes like heaviness or tightness may appear. This phase can last months or years. Critical window for action includes:
- Arm or leg elevation to encourage drainage.
- Monitoring for pitting edema (indents when pressed).
Stage 1: Reversible Swelling
Swelling resolves with elevation or compression. Key features:
- Soft tissue indentation (pitting edema).
- Volume increases up to 20% compared to the unaffected limb.
Stage 2: Persistent Swelling
Tissue hardens, and swelling no longer fully reverses. Data shows:
| Characteristic | Stage 2 | Stage 3 |
|---|---|---|
| Volume Difference | 20–40% (ISL) | 50%+ |
| Infection Risk | Moderate | 300% higher (NLN) |
| Tissue Texture | Fibrosis begins | Severe thickening |
Stage 3: Severe and Irreversible Changes
Skin becomes leathery, and mobility declines. Red flags include:
- Non-pitting edema (no indentation).
- Recurrent infections due to poor immunity.
Cross-section diagrams reveal advanced fibrosis blocking fluid pathways. Emergency care is needed for open wounds or sudden swelling.
Effective Management Strategies for Lymphedema
Managing swelling effectively requires proven techniques tailored to individual needs. Early intervention with the right therapy can significantly improve outcomes. Below are three evidence-based approaches to reduce discomfort and enhance mobility.
Manual Lymphatic Drainage (MLD)
This specialized massage directs fluid toward healthy nodes. Studies show MLD reduces volume by 29% when started early (Ridner SH et al.). Key techniques include:
- Light pressure: Gentle strokes follow lymphatic pathways.
- Directional movement: Fluid is guided upward, away from swollen areas.
Certified therapists teach patients to perform MLD at home. Sessions typically last 30–45 minutes.
Compression Therapy and Garments
Custom sleeves or stockings apply controlled pressure (30–50mmHg) to prevent fluid buildup. The DECONGEST protocol combines:
| Garment Type | Best For | Pressure Level |
|---|---|---|
| Flat-knit | Severe swelling | 40–50mmHg |
| Circular-knit | Mild cases | 20–30mmHg |
Avoid pneumatic devices if you have heart failure or infections.
Exercise and Physical Therapy
Low-impact activities like swimming boost circulation. A home program might include:
- Resistance bands: 10 reps daily to strengthen muscles.
- Stretching: Improves range of motion in stiff joints.
Medicare often covers supplies like sleeves if prescribed. Always consult your care team before starting new routines.
Preventing Lymphedema During and After Chemotherapy
Proactive steps can significantly lower the chances of developing swelling issues after cancer treatment. Focus on skin protection and healthy habits to reduce risk and improve long-term comfort.
Skin Care and Infection Prevention
Proper skin care cuts cellulitis risk by 67% (NCCN). Follow these steps:
- Cleanse gently: Use pH-balanced soaps to avoid irritation.
- Moisturize daily: Fragrance-free lotions prevent cracks that invite infections.
- Shave safely: Electric razors reduce cuts compared to blades.
Avoid high-risk activities like hot tubs, tattoos, or blood pressure cuffs on affected limbs.
Lifestyle Adjustments to Reduce Risk
Small changes make a big difference. Start with:
- Exercise: The Schmitz protocol recommends graded weight lifting to boost circulation.
- Hydrate: Aim for 35ml of water per kg of body weight daily.
- Limit sodium: Processed foods worsen fluid retention.
Maintaining a healthy BMI lowers swelling risk threefold (ACS). Track progress with a journal or app.
Advanced Treatments for Severe Lymphedema
For patients with persistent swelling, advanced medical interventions can provide significant relief. When compression or therapy falls short, specialized surgery may restore drainage and reduce discomfort.
Surgical Options: Lymphovenous Bypass and Lymph Node Transfer
Microsurgical techniques like lymphovenous bypass reroute fluid around blocked vessels. Studies show a 68% volume reduction (Mayo Clinic). Vascularized lymph node transfers (VLNT) transplant healthy nodes to damaged areas.
Patient selection is critical. Ideal candidates have: lymphedema chemotherapy
- Stage 2–3 swelling unresponsive to therapy.
- No active infections or heart disease.
Post-op care includes:
| Procedure | Recovery Time | Success Rate |
|---|---|---|
| Bypass | 2–4 weeks | 75% |
| VLNT | 6–8 weeks | 82% |
Liposuction for Fat Reduction
Suction-assisted protein lipectomy (SAPL) removes hardened tissues in late-stage cases. It extracts 4–6 liters of fat (ISL) but requires lifelong compression wear.
Combining SAPL with physical therapy improves ability to move. Insurance often covers these treatments if documented as medically necessary. Pre-authorization typically requires:
- 6 months of failed conservative therapy.
- Photos and limb measurements.
Living with Lymphedema: Tips for Daily Care
Adjusting to life with swelling challenges requires practical daily strategies and emotional resilience. Small changes to routines and access to support can significantly improve comfort and confidence.
Adapting Your Routine
Clothing choices matter. Opt for seamless garments to reduce irritation, and use compression sleeves for arm or leg swelling. At night, elevate limbs with pillows to encourage drainage.
Modified yoga poses, like legs-up-the-wall, promote lymphatic flow. Focus on gentle movements that respect your body’s limits. Workplace adjustments—such as ergonomic chairs or frequent breaks—help manage discomfort.
Emotional and Psychological Support
42% of people report better quality of life with support groups (LE&RN). Online forums offer convenience, while in-person groups foster deeper connections.
Mindfulness techniques, like deep breathing, reduce stress tied to chronic conditions. Track progress in a journal to celebrate small wins. Remember, care extends beyond physical needs—mental health matters too.
